1931, 2¢ Yorktown, specialized collection housed in eight albums/binders and six sheet files with singles, blocks, plate blocks and strips and sheets; includes a comprehensive plate numbers and positions section with hundreds of plate pairs, blocks and strips encompassing nearly all (if not all) numbers and combinations, in addition there are approximately 130 full sheets showing different plate number combinations (Scott cat $7,100+ alone), many designer/engraver signed items as well as a letter and notes regarding this issue, used multiples, shade study including #703a blocks, vignette shifts, cover section including better hand-painted FDC's and a full sheet used tied on cover with first day cancels and "Wethersfield, Conn. 150th Anniv. of the Surrender of Yorktown" red and green event cancels, other event covers, large album of collateral items, etc.; wonderful specialty collection and a truly ideal basis for further continuation.Scott No. 703 Estimate $2,500 - 3,500.
